Middle Tennessee experiences significant seasonal temperature fluctuations, with summer temperatures routinely exceeding 90°F alongside high relative humidity. Heat exposure during transit can threaten the structural stability of delicate peptide chains if protective packaging and rapid logistics are not utilized.
Lyophilized (freeze-dried) Tesamorelin exhibits strong thermal stability when kept in its unconstituted solid state. However, prolonged exposure to ambient heat during carrier transit can accelerate degradation pathways such as oxidation or hydrolysis. Tesamorelin is a synthetic 44-amino acid peptide analog of human Growth Hormone-Releasing Hormone (GHRH). It features a trans-3-hexenoic acid group attached to its N-terminal amino acid sequence, a structural modification designed to enhance enzymatic stability against dipeptidyl peptidase-4 (DPP-4) degradation compared to native endogenous GHRH.
In preclinical and in vitro research models, Tesamorelin functions as a selective GHRH receptor agonist. Upon binding to functional GHRH receptors on pituitary somatotropes, it stimulates the synthesis and pulsatile secretion of endogenous growth hormone (GH). Elevated GH concentrations subsequently upregulate systemic concentrations of Insulin-like Growth Factor 1 (IGF-1), driving downstream signaling cascades involved in cellular proliferation, protein synthesis, and metabolic homeostasis.
Primary research applications for Tesamorelin focus on metabolic regulation, visceral adiposity models, lipid metabolism modulation, and tissue-repair signaling pathways. When designing endo-metabolic research protocols, lab personnel often evaluate Tesamorelin against alternative GHRH analogs and growth hormone secretagogues (GHS) to determine optimal receptor affinity and half-life characteristics for their specific experimental models.
Tesamorelin is specifically distinguished by its intact 44-amino acid sequence and N-terminal stabilization, closely mimicking natural physiological GHRH pulsatility while offering enhanced plasma stability. In contrast, modified truncated analogs such as CJC-1295 No DAC consist of a 29-amino acid core structure designed for rapid receptor engagement.
Other secretagogues operate via distinct receptor pathways entirely. For instance, ghrelin receptor agonists like Ipamorelin target the Growth Hormone Secretagogue Receptor (GHSR-1a) rather than the GHRH receptor. Researchers frequently study combined GHRH agonist and GHSR agonist configurations to analyze potential synergistic GH release dynamics in cell culture and animal models.

Reversed-Phase High-Performance Liquid Chromatography (RP-HPLC) is utilized to determine overall chemical purity and quantify individual impurity peaks. A sharp, single analytical peak confirms peptide homogeneity and validates that total purity exceeds 98%. Simultaneously, Electrospray Ionization Mass Spectrometry (ESI-MS) confirms the exact molecular mass of the 44-amino acid sequence, verifying structural identity down to the Dalton.
Furthermore, biological assays are highly sensitive to bacterial endotoxins (lipopolysaccharides). High endotoxin concentrations introduce uncontrolled confounding variables in cell viability and inflammatory signaling experiments.
